Job Title: Head of Innovation and Asset Manager Relations

If you’re looking for a career that will help you stand out, join HSBC, and fulfil your potential - whether you want a career that could take you to the top, or an exciting new direction, we offer opportunities, support and rewards that will take you further.

We’re one of the largest banking and financial services organisations in the world, with a network that covers more than 50 countries and territories. We aim to be where the growth is, enabling businesses to thrive and economies to prosper, and, ultimately, helping people fulfil their hopes and realise their ambitions.

We're currently seeking an experienced professional to join our team in the role of Head of Innovation and Asset Manager Relations. This is suited to a mid-career professional looking to broaden exposure through a global, cross-asset role.

Global Manager Selection serves as our centre of excellence for fund manager selection, research, and approval, encompassing mutual funds, Exchange Traded Funds (ETFs), and emerging investment vehicles. With dedicated teams in London, Hong Kong, and Bangalore, the team drives innovation across a broad range of asset classes, including Equity, Fixed Income, Multi-Asset, and sustainable investments. As Head of Innovation and Asset Manager Relations, you’ll spearhead the strategic evolution of our fund platform, championing cutting-edge investment solutions such as tokenised funds, public-private partnerships, and active ETFs. You’ll be responsible for building and nurturing impactful relationships with asset managers, driving product innovation, and ensuring we remain at the forefront of industry trends and client needs. You'll report directly to our Global Head of Funds, ETFs and Manager Selection, and will be part of the Global Manager Selection Leadership Team.

As an HSBC employee in the UK, you’ll have access to tailored professional development opportunities and a competitive pay and benefits package. This includes private healthcare for all UK-based employees, enhanced maternity and adoption pay and support when you return to work, and a contributory pension scheme with a generous employer contribution.

In this role you’ll:

  • Spearhead the development and adoption of innovative investment products, including tokenised funds, public-private investment vehicles, and active ETFs, ensuring our offering remains market-leading and future-ready
  • Build and manage relationships with global asset managers, fostering collaboration to co-create new products and enhance existing offerings for our clients
  • Collaborate with technology and product teams to integrate digital assets and tokenisation into the fund platform, ensuring robust governance and compliance
  • Provide strategic insights on emerging trends in asset management, including the evolution of public-private partnerships and the rise of active ETFs, sharing knowledge with internal stakeholders and clients
  • Lead regular engagement programmes with strategic partners, the Chief Investment Office, and our senior stakeholders to align priorities and drive innovation
  • Inspire and develop a high-performing team of innovation and asset manager relations professionals, fostering a culture of collaboration, accountability, and continuous improvement

To be successful in this role you should meet the following requirements:

  • Proven experience in asset management, with a strong record of driving innovation and leading strategic partnerships
  • Deep knowledge of financial markets, investment products, and emerging trends such as tokenisation, digital assets, and active ETFs
  • Demonstrated ability to launch and manage complex investment solutions, including navigating regulatory environments and market entry
  • Strong analytical skills, with the capability to turn market intelligence into actionable strategies
  • Excellent communication, negotiation, and inclusive leadership skills, with experience managing diverse teams and influencing senior stakeholders
  • Advanced proficiency in Microsoft Office (Excel, PowerPoint), with experience in digital transformation, sustainable investing, or working across global teams considered advantageous
